Output 61dfd808610c53de7f3f7fa24253aa3e14bcddfefb6beef522b3682212bf3a0f:0

value
94435
script pubkey
OP_0 OP_PUSHBYTES_20 34f200a33479a5729dd5cf295f35fcce14f164d7
address
bc1qxneqpge50xjh98w4eu547d0uec20zexhzg90x8
transaction
61dfd808610c53de7f3f7fa24253aa3e14bcddfefb6beef522b3682212bf3a0f
confirmations
30186
spent
true